Subject: Potential acquisition — Dunwarry Analytics

Finance team,

We have entered preliminary diligence on Dunwarry Analytics, a forty-person firm based in Calverton. Their Lattice engine would replace our aging reporting stack and shorten the Harrowgate roadmap by roughly a year. Purchase would be mostly cash with a small equity component; their leadership has signaled openness to a three-year earnout. Please begin building the integration cost model this week. Model assumptions should reflect the strategic direction stated below.

management briefing: The northern region missed its Jorael quota by 14.5 percent last quarter. Nordorax Logistics plans to lower the Casdor list price by 61.4 percent in July. The board signed off on a budget of $219.8 million for Project Tamax. The renewal with Briielax Foods closes at $51.2 million a year, 65.4 percent above the last contract.

## Runbook: Largediff Viewer — Oversized File Handling

The Largediff viewer in Cartwheel streams files over 50 MB in 4 MB chunks rather than loading them whole. If a contractor reports a frozen diff pane, first check that chunked mode is enabled; full-load mode on large files exhausts the render worker. Restarting the worker clears stuck sessions but loses scroll position. When you escalate to the platform team, always paste the viewer's build token, shown below.

session token of tajef-bageg = htk21_5d90d574934f3ccae6437

Ticket: FabriKit config drift between CI and developer machines

Several support cases this week trace back to the FabriKit test-data factory generating different seed records locally than in CI. Quinella confirmed the drift began after the Marrowgate cluster upgrade; locally cached overrides were never updated. Please verify affected customers against the canonical settings before reseeding. The current reference configuration is reproduced below.

service settings:
PRAWYN_PIN=9848
PRAWYN_METRICS_HOST=metrics.prawyn.lumicworks.corp
PRAWYN_LOG_LEVEL=warn
PRAWYN_TENANT=pelius